Jamie O’Hara believes his former side Tottenham should sell a couple of players in order to fund a move for Aston Villa skipper Jack Grealish.
While the ex-Spurs and Wolves midfielder is a big fan of Grealish’s talents, he does hold the view that the £80million price tag that has been slapped on him is completely unrealistic in this market.
“He’s had a great season, he would be brilliant for Spurs,” O’Hara told Thursday’s talkSPORT Breakfast.
“We should have got him a season ago when he was a lot cheaper. I don’t know if Spurs have got the money, maybe if they offload a couple. He would be great.
“I think it’s time for him to step up if he wants to be an England player; he needs to be a team near the top six.
“He’s not worth £80m; I love him, but in the current market, absolutely no chance [is he worth that].”
Villa are reportedly planning on offering Grealish a bumper new deal in order to fend off interest in their most prized asset.
The 24-year-old starred for Dean Smith’s side in 2019/20 as they beat the drop – scoring 10 times and creating eight more.
Grealish’s current deal runs out in the summer of 2023.
